About me / Bio:
Subhash Mukhopadhyay was an Indian physician and scientist who achieved a remarkable feat in the field of reproductive medicine. He was the first person in India and the second in the world to successfully create a test tube baby using in-vitro fertilisation (IVF) technique. He performed this procedure with the help of his colleagues Sunit Mukherji and Saroj Kanti Bhattacharya, using basic equipment and a refrigerator in his own apartment. The baby girl, named Durga (alias Kanupriya Agarwal), was born on 3 October 1978, just 67 days after the first IVF baby in the United Kingdom. However, instead of receiving recognition and support for his groundbreaking work, Mukhopadhyay faced social ostracisation, bureaucratic negligence, reprimand and insult from the West Bengal state government and the Indian medical establishment. He was not allowed to share his achievements with the international scientific community or attend any conferences. He was also subjected to a humiliating inquiry by a committee of experts who had no knowledge of modern reproductive technology and who dismissed his claims as bogus. Dejected and depressed by the lack of appreciation and acknowledgement, Mukhopadhyay committed suicide on 19 June 1981 by overdosing on sleeping pills. His death was largely ignored by the media and the public at that time. It was only after his colleague T.C. Anand Kumar, who was credited as the mastermind behind India's official first test tube baby in 1986, reviewed Mukhopadhyay's personal notes and confirmed his pioneering work that he started to receive some belated recognition and respect. His life and death have been the subject of several newspaper articles, books, documentaries and films. He is widely regarded as one of the unsung heroes of Indian science and medicine who deserved better treatment and appreciation for his contributions to the field of reproductive biology.
